Biography

Born, raised and educated in the Palestinian city of Nablus, the researcher received his BA in English at the Univ. of Jordan, MA in linguistics at Indiana Univ. and has been involved in a PhD research on pragmatics in translation. Work experience mostly includes teaching at higher education institutes and universities. Currently, I am working at an Najah National University as a lecturer of English.
